diff options
author |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2016-12-24 09:22:21 +0000 |
---|---|---|
committer | nobu <nobu@b2dd03c8-39d4-4d8f-98ff-823fe69b080e> | 2016-12-24 09:22:21 +0000 |
commit | 703e930e0943ae29344b0dea86ff2c2a42e4c51f (patch) | |
tree | 0c429ab7e2ac9d606af2887bdcb19b34e09c2f79 /test/lib | |
parent | ea7e4639f61a91c83840a4a65eaba2a379ef5f3b (diff) | |
download | ruby-703e930e0943ae29344b0dea86ff2c2a42e4c51f.tar.gz |
test/unit.rb: restore parallel option
* test/lib/test/unit.rb (_run_parallel): restore parallel option
after retrying for --repeat-count option.
git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@57169 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
Diffstat (limited to 'test/lib')
-rw-r--r-- | test/lib/test/unit.rb |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/test/lib/test/unit.rb b/test/lib/test/unit.rb index 30ead34d0f..e8ab158f11 100644 --- a/test/lib/test/unit.rb +++ b/test/lib/test/unit.rb @@ -445,6 +445,7 @@ module Test quit_workers unless @interrupt || !@options[:retry] || @need_quit + parallel = @options[:parallel] @options[:parallel] = false suites, rep = rep.partition {|r| r[:testcase] && r[:file] && r[:report].any? {|e| !e[2].is_a?(MiniTest::Skip)}} suites.map {|r| r[:file]}.uniq.each {|file| require file} @@ -454,6 +455,7 @@ module Test puts "\n""Retrying..." _run_suites(suites, type) end + @options[:parallel] = parallel end unless @options[:retry] del_status_line or puts |